When searching for a bunk bed, it's vital to understand the different types readily available. Here is a breakdown of the most popular styles:
1. Requirement Bunk Beds
Standard bunk beds consist of two beds stacked on top of each other. They are usually simple in design and extremely practical.
2. Loft Beds
Loft beds elevate the sleeping area while leaving the space below open for other uses, like a desk or play location. This alternative is excellent for studios or children's rooms.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
L-shaped bunk beds feature 2 beds set up perpendicularly to each other. This style can typically include extra functions such as built-in racks or a staircase.
4. Twin-over-Full Bunk Beds
This design consists of a twin bed on the leading and a fuller-sized bed on the bottom, appealing to both kids and teenagers.
5. Bunk Beds with Trundle
These bunk beds include an extra bed that can be taken out from beneath the bottom bunk, perfect for slumber parties.
6. Custom-made Bunk Beds
Many manufacturers use custom-made designs to fit distinct dimensions or themes, making them perfect for particular space layouts.

Q2: How can I take full advantage of storage with a bunk bed?
Consider bunk beds with built-in drawers or storage racks underneath the bottom bed, or utilize the space below the bed for bins or boxes.
Q3: What is the optimum allowable weight for bunk beds?
Most twin bunk beds can accommodate around 200-250 pounds per bed. Constantly consult the producer for specific weight limitations.
Q4: Can I separate a bunk bed into two single beds?
Many bunk beds are designed to be converted into 2 separate beds, but it's vital to confirm this choice with the producer.
